    • Disclosed are an apparatus and a method for normalizing an image of a driver's face in a predetermined size on the center of a monitor by automatically controlling a lens when the image of the driver's face is detected. The apparatus includes a lens for photographing a driver's face, a first motor for moving the lens in a forward or rearward direction in order to adjust a zoom parameter, a second motor for moving the lens in a horizontal or vertical direction in order to adjust a pan parameter or a tilt parameter, and a controller for extracting an initial face area from a photographed image and controlling operations of the first motor and the second motor according to the extracted initial face area.

    • Provided is a vehicle detection/tracking device that allows vehicle detection and then tracking using a camera focusing around a camera-mounted vehicle. To this end, an optical flow is acquired from video data input through a camera mounted in a vehicle during driving of the vehicle. A background optical flow, an optical flow generated by driving the vehicle, is acquired. The acquired optical flow and the acquired background optical flow are compared, and a vehicle candidate area is detected through an optical flow for an object around the vehicle. In particular, template matching is performed on the vehicle candidate area for vehicle detection and a detected vehicle can be tracked by continuously comparing the detected optical flow and the background optical flow.
